diff options
Diffstat (limited to 'plugins/mm-modem-novatel-cdma.c')
-rw-r--r-- | plugins/mm-modem-novatel-cdma.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/plugins/mm-modem-novatel-cdma.c b/plugins/mm-modem-novatel-cdma.c index 679b3b87..c578d18b 100644 --- a/plugins/mm-modem-novatel-cdma.c +++ b/plugins/mm-modem-novatel-cdma.c @@ -98,7 +98,7 @@ get_one_qual (const char *reply, const char *tag) } static void -get_rssi_done (MMSerialPort *port, +get_rssi_done (MMAtSerialPort *port, GString *response, GError *error, gpointer user_data) @@ -143,10 +143,10 @@ get_signal_quality (MMModemCdma *modem, { MMGenericCdma *cdma = MM_GENERIC_CDMA (modem); MMCallbackInfo *info; - MMSerialPort *primary, *secondary, *port; + MMAtSerialPort *primary, *secondary, *port; - port = primary = mm_generic_cdma_get_port (cdma, MM_PORT_TYPE_PRIMARY); - secondary = mm_generic_cdma_get_port (cdma, MM_PORT_TYPE_SECONDARY); + port = primary = mm_generic_cdma_get_at_port (cdma, MM_PORT_TYPE_PRIMARY); + secondary = mm_generic_cdma_get_at_port (cdma, MM_PORT_TYPE_SECONDARY); info = mm_callback_info_uint_new (MM_MODEM (modem), callback, user_data); @@ -166,7 +166,7 @@ get_signal_quality (MMModemCdma *modem, * reply doesn't appear to be in positive dBm either; instead try the custom * Novatel command for it. */ - mm_serial_port_queue_command (port, "$NWRSSI", 3, get_rssi_done, info); + mm_at_serial_port_queue_command (port, "$NWRSSI", 3, get_rssi_done, info); } /*****************************************************************************/ |